Niagara is a modern autoflowering strain developed from Lowryder genetics. Designed for simplicity and accessibility in both indoor and outdoor cultivation, this variety maintains a short 75-day flowering cycle. While it is characterized by a low yield, its ease of growth makes it a practical selection for cultivators seeking a concise, automated life cycle. Its genetic lineage has further expanded through hybridization, most notably in the creation of its offspring, Niagara x Shiva.

The sensory profile of Niagara is defined by a complex terpene hierarchy led by caryophyllene and nerolidol, followed by humulene, limonene, myrcene, linalool, beta-pinene, and pinene. This specific arrangement of aromatic compounds creates a distinct chemical signature that informs the strain’s overall profile. These terpenes work in concert to define the nuanced essence of the flower, ensuring a profile that is chemically diverse and analytically consistent.

As a THC-dominant variety, Niagara is sought after for its specific physiological impact, which is primarily described as relaxed, happy, and uplifted. These characteristics make it a functional candidate for users looking to manage stress and pain, or to facilitate the onset of sleep. Its balanced effects and straightforward cultivation requirements consolidate its reputation as a reliable, modern genetic option for both medicinal use and personal gardening.
